Pair Trading with Us Government and Wells Fargo
The main advantage of trading using opposite Us Government and Wells Fargo positions is that it hedges away some unsystematic risk. Because of two separate transactions, even if Us Government position performs unexpectedly, Wells Fargo can make up some of the losses. Pair trading also minimizes risk from directional movements in the market.
